Situated in the heart of Huntsville's stunning lake system, boasting over 40 miles of boating opportunities- 4 Bedroom, 4 bathroom, Plans for an extensive front deck offering stunning lake views, Deck to also include a covered patio area and Muskoka room, Partially built lakefront cottage features full ICF to the roof with an insulated and heated basement slab, 4 inches of rigid foam on the ceiling, 4 heat sources including the main gas furnace for whole home heating with suplemenatry condensing navion boiler to heat in floor heat with line set run out to heat future garage. Boiler has enough heat to heat the house as a back up. Heat pump ugrade on the A/C to heat the house in the shoulder season. Gas fireplace on the main floor. Watefront features include owned shore road allowance, clean, shallow, sandy bottom. Boathouse with boatlift, sunfilled dock with stairs.
